  1. Note:
    I've encountered some performance issues but that was only during the first day, today I played the game for a long time to make sure the issue did not come back. Performance has been consistent for me today, I was getting around 50-55 FPS all the time, which I think is good enough.
    Yesterday when the issue happened, the FPS dropped to around 30 to 40, making the game experience super bad. TBH I'm still 100% clueless why it happened, but for now I'll take it as an isolated bug and keep an eye on it.
    If you have an S23 device and also experience some inconsistent gaming performance, you may try to reboot your device a few times, wait for a few hours, it might resolve by itself. Please also share your experiences so that I can understand better what's the real cause.

  2. consider doing future tests without "bloom", as it is one of the most demanding setting for gpu as there are a ton of transparent effects during combat which are rendered multiple times. people won't have to sacrifice by switching to medium or low settings to get better performance, also during fights you can't see anything properly due to bloom(too much glow) & rather than having smooth combat you get frame drops & laggy gameplay.
